Many older adults try to maintain their independence, even when everyday tasks become difficult. Watch for these five warning signs: ✔ Missed medications ✔ Unopened mail piling up ✔ Weight loss or spoiled food ✔ Poor personal hygiene ✔ Frequent falls or close calls One sign doesn't always mean there's a serious problem—but several together may indicate it's time for a conversation.
